  • Thank you for your interest in Next Mission Living. We provide safe, structured, and substance-free independent living housing for veterans and adults who are ready to work toward stability and long-term independence.

    This application is used for initial screening only. Submission does not guarantee acceptance or housing availability. Next Mission Living is not a medical facility, detoxification center, assisted living facility, or provider of hands-on personal care.
